Hotel Essex has opened on Michigan Avenue adjacent to Grant Park. Formerly the Essex Inn, the 274-room property, which is managed by Oxford Hotels & Resorts, underwent a multimillion-dollar renovation. For meetings and events, the hotel has a 1,239-square-foot venue and a 1,600-square-foot private space at SX Sky Bar, a bi-level restaurant and lounge.

NORWALK, CONNECTICUT: LaKota Oaks, a 66-acre hotel and conference center that was formerly Dolce Norwalk, has opened after a multimillion-dollar renovation of its ballroom, meeting spaces, guest rooms, and fitness center. The 123-room property has 35 meeting and event spaces, the largest of which can seat 480 theater style.
